TahoeDawg,...You mentioned in one post above that the 2008.5 Precedent moved the control section behind the seat and this is the model I have,..with 4 +12 batts. It appears there is some kind of plastic center strut in the bottom of the bucket so I'm not sure the 6-8votls would fit in there without a modification of the bucket. Do you know anything about this??? Thanks for all your help to everyone on the forum.

They'll fit. Youll have to order the two plastic 8V battery hold downs. They're cheap. There is a plastic piece towards the back of the bucket that just snaps out when you use the 8Vs.... You're gonna need to change the On-Board computer to get full potential from the 8Vs. The one currently in the car has software configured to charge 12s.. Here's what it will look like.

I'm thinking of converting to this arrangement. I'm brand new at golf carting and so my question is where is the OBC on an '08 Precedent located and what type of replacement should I procure to handle the 6X8 volt configuration? Is it difficult and is there any programming necessary? Thanks.

The OBC is the grey component you see in the silver aluminum panel behind the batteries. It's easy to change, and no there's no programming necessary. The OBC you purchase is all according to what kind of batteries you're using. Contact me when you decide what batteries you'll use and I'll give you the correct part number.

TahoeDawg,you mentioned changing the onboard computer in th 08 Precedent, Would this be for all 08 Precedents? What is the approximate cost of this part? Thanks a million times for your help.

It would apply to any Club Car vehicle, not just Precedents. As long as you're converting from 12s to 8s you need to change the OBC.... Check with site sponsors about a price. Not sure what kind of batteries you're using, but here's a few examples..

8V Trojans or Crown - OBC with Algorithm 1, version 5.0 or higher for Bucket style 2
8V US Battery - OBC with Algorithm 2, version 5.0 or higher for Bucket style 2
